Analysis

The most recent figure for free and fair elections index in Canada is 0.944, measured in 2025.

The figure is up 0.7% on the previous year and up 5.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, free and fair elections index in Canada peaked at 0.95 in 2020 and was at its lowest, 0.459, in 1841.

That places Canada 16th out of 176 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 185 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1840s 0.597 0.459 0.62 9
1850s 0.6184 0.612 0.624 10
1860s 0.6188 0.615 0.621 10
1870s 0.6207 0.615 0.642 10
1880s 0.6412 0.639 0.642 10
1890s 0.6404 0.639 0.641 10
1900s 0.6736 0.645 0.682 10
1910s 0.653 0.549 0.682 10
1920s 0.7668 0.613 0.801 10
1930s 0.819 0.807 0.824 10
1940s 0.828 0.824 0.838 10
1950s 0.8586 0.847 0.866 10
1960s 0.8803 0.864 0.888 10
1970s 0.9087 0.899 0.918 10
1980s 0.9184 0.917 0.92 10
1990s 0.9254 0.917 0.933 10
2000s 0.936 0.928 0.942 10
2010s 0.917 0.889 0.941 10
2020s 0.942 0.937 0.95 6

Central estimate of the extent to which registration fraud, systematic irregularities, government intimidation of the opposition, vote buying, and election violence are absent, and the election management body is autonomous and has enough staff and resources.
